Qufu is located in the southwest of Shandong Province. It is the hometown of Confucius and one of China's historical and cultural cities. Here is a travel guide to Qufu to help you plan your trip:
Main attractions
Confucius Temple: One of the largest Confucius temples in China, built in 478 BC, is the main place for worshiping Confucius. The architecture is magnificent and has a profound cultural heritage.
- **Kong Mansion**: The residence of Confucius' descendants, adjacent to the Confucius Temple, shows the life scenes of ancient nobles.
Cemetery of Confucius: The cemetery of the Confucius family, covering an area of about 200 hectares, is the largest and longest-lasting family cemetery in China.
Nishan Sacred Land: The birthplace of Confucius, the scenic area has a statue of Confucius, a university hall, etc., suitable for experiencing Confucian culture.
Yan Temple: A temple dedicated to Confucius' disciple Yan Hui, small in scale but with a long history.
Zhougong Temple: A temple dedicated to Zhougong, one of the saints revered by Confucianism.
Food recommendations
Kong Mansion cuisine: Traditional dishes from Kong Mansion, exquisite and ceremonial, recommended to try Kong Mansion Yipin Pot, Shili Ginkgo, etc.
Qufu smoked tofu: A local specialty snack, tofu is smoked and has a unique flavor.
Pancake roll with green onion: A traditional Shandong snack, pancakes rolled with green onions and sauce, simple and delicious.
Qufu mutton soup: A good choice for warming up in winter, with fresh soup and tender meat.
